Unveiling the Best Campgrounds Near Orlando Stadium

When it comes to camping stadium Orlando Florida, location is key. You'll want to find a campground that offers easy access to both the stadium and the surrounding attractions. Fortunately, there are several excellent options to choose from, each with its own unique charm and amenities. Let's explore some of the top picks:

  • Lake Louisa State Park: Located just a short drive from Orlando, Lake Louisa State Park is a true gem for camping. This park boasts stunning natural beauty, with numerous lakes, rolling hills, and lush forests. You can choose from various camping options, including tent camping, RV camping, and even primitive camping for a more rugged experience. The park also offers a range of activities, such as hiking, biking, swimming, and fishing.   • Wekiwa Springs State Park: If you're looking for a refreshing camping experience, Wekiwa Springs State Park is the place to be. This park is renowned for its crystal-clear natural springs, where you can swim, snorkel, and cool off from the Florida heat. The campground offers both tent and RV sites, and you'll be surrounded by a beautiful forest. Besides swimming, you can also enjoy hiking, canoeing, and kayaking.   • Disney's Fort Wilderness Resort & Campground: For those who want a touch of Disney magic with their camping experience, Fort Wilderness is an excellent option. This resort and campground offers a unique camping experience with various amenities, including pools, restaurants, and recreational activities. You can choose from tent sites, RV sites, and even cabins. Plus, you'll have easy access to Disney's theme parks and other attractions.   • Kelly Park / Rock Springs Run State Reserve: This park offers a more natural and rustic camping experience. It's known for its beautiful natural springs and the Rock Springs Run river, where you can enjoy tubing, canoeing, and kayaking. The campground has tent and RV sites, and you'll be surrounded by a peaceful forest.   • Orlando / Kissimmee KOA: If you're looking for a campground with a wide range of amenities, the Orlando / Kissimmee KOA is worth considering. This campground offers tent sites, RV sites, and cabins, along with a swimming pool, playground, and other recreational facilities. It's a great option for families with kids. Plus, its location provides easy access to the stadium and other Orlando attractions.

Essential Tips for Camping Near the Stadium

Alright, now that you know about some of the best campgrounds, let's go over some essential tips to ensure your camping stadium Orlando Florida trip is a success. These tips will help you stay safe, comfortable, and make the most of your outdoor adventure:

  • Plan Ahead: Book your campsite well in advance, especially if you're traveling during peak season. Popular campgrounds fill up quickly, so don't wait until the last minute. Research the campgrounds and choose the one that best suits your needs and preferences. For instance, consider amenities, proximity to the stadium, and the types of activities you want to enjoy. Check weather forecasts and pack accordingly.

  • Pack the Right Gear: Make sure you have all the necessary camping gear, including a tent, sleeping bags, sleeping pads, cooking equipment, and a cooler. Don't forget essentials like insect repellent, sunscreen, a first-aid kit, and a flashlight or headlamp. Also, pack comfortable clothing and footwear suitable for outdoor activities. Bring extra batteries for your devices.

  • Follow Campground Rules: Familiarize yourself with the campground rules and regulations before you arrive. This includes quiet hours, fire restrictions, and waste disposal procedures. Be respectful of other campers and the environment. Keep your campsite clean and leave no trace behind. Properly dispose of trash and recycling. Obey any fire restrictions that might be in place.

  • Stay Hydrated and Safe: Drink plenty of water to stay hydrated, especially in the Florida heat. Bring a reusable water bottle and refill it regularly. Be aware of the risks of wildlife encounters and take necessary precautions, such as storing food properly. Keep a safe distance from wild animals. Always let someone know your plans and expected return time. Carry a map and compass or a GPS device to navigate the trails.

Unforgettable Activities During Your Camping Adventure

Beyond the thrill of camping stadium Orlando Florida, there's a whole world of exciting activities to enjoy. Here are some ideas to make your camping trip even more memorable:

  • Hiking and Biking: Explore the many hiking and biking trails around the campgrounds. Discover hidden waterfalls, scenic overlooks, and diverse ecosystems. Pack a picnic and enjoy lunch amidst nature. Check out the park's trail maps and choose trails that match your fitness level.

  • Water Activities: Many campgrounds offer access to lakes, rivers, or springs, perfect for swimming, canoeing, kayaking, or paddleboarding. Rent equipment or bring your own. Always wear a life jacket and follow water safety guidelines. Enjoy the refreshing cool water and soak up the sun.

  • Wildlife Viewing: Keep an eye out for local wildlife, such as birds, deer, and alligators. Bring binoculars and a camera to capture the moment. Remember to observe wildlife from a safe distance and never feed them.

  • Stargazing: Escape the city lights and enjoy the beauty of the night sky. Find a spot away from artificial light and gaze at the stars. Bring a telescope or binoculars for a closer look. Check the astronomical calendar for meteor showers and other celestial events.

  • Campfire Fun: Build a campfire (where permitted) and enjoy the classic camping experience. Roast marshmallows, tell stories, and sing songs around the fire. Remember to follow fire safety guidelines and never leave a campfire unattended.
